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ser

Best inexpensive facial cleanser

pros
  • Gentle
  • Water-soluble
  • Nondrying
  • Affordable
cons
  • Not a good makeup remover
  • Not suitable for oily skin

Not glamorous, but very effective, February 21, 2009

I received a free sample of this product from my dermatologist. I had been reluctant to purchase it because it was so very unglamorous. However, it has been a godsend to my combination skin. I very rarely break out, and when I do it is much less severe than it used to be, and I don't use any acne medications. I used to think that I needed to use harsh cleansers to clean the oil from my skin, but in fact, those harsh cleansers strip your skin so severely they increase oil production. No other product makes my skin as soft and smooth. It's also perfect for delicate areas such as your decolletage and feminine regions, and cleans makeup without irritating skin or eyes. When I want to exfoliate a few times a week I use Cetaphil with a teaspoon of sea salt. Works like a charm.

Our Sources

1. Beautypedia.com

Begoun says that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ser is extremely gentle and that it is especially good for sensitive skin or for those who are "prone to skin conditions such as eczema or psoriasis." She does say, however, that the cleanser doesn't remove makeup well.

Review: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ser, Paula Begoun

2. Allure

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ser is listed in Allure's hall of fame because it has won beauty awards for nine years. Experts at Allure say that the cleanser has only eight ingredients, which is why it is so gentle.

Review: Hall of Fame, Editors of Allure, Oct. 2007

3. InStyle

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ser is named the best cleanser for dry skin by editors of InStyle magazine. They say that the cleanser is a winner year after year because it is very gentle. Dermatologists recommend applying it without water and wiping it off with a damp cloth.

Review: Best Beauty Buys 2009: Skin, Editors of InStyle, April 2009

4. About.com

About.com's beauty guide, Julyne Derrick, recommends facial cleansers for several skin types, from "cheap to steep." Cetaphil cleansers are recommended for dry skin, normal/combination skin and sensitive skin. Derrick says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ser is "the best drugstore cleanser." (Note: ConsumerSearch is owned by About.com, but the two don't share an editorial affiliation.)

Review: The Best Face Cleansers on the Market, Julyne Derrick

5. MakeupAlley.com

Several consumers at MakeupAlley.com say that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ser clears their skin of redness, irritation and even blemishes. Many, however, say that the cleanser does not do a good job of removing makeup.

Review: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ser, Contributors to MakeupAlley.com

6. TotalBeauty.com

Editors and users at TotalBeauty.com say that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ser is a gentle cleanser that doesn't irritate the skin. It doesn't remove makeup well, however.

Review: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ser, Contributors to TotalBeauty.com

7. Drugstore.com

Consumers posting to Drugstore.com give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ser an average rating of four out of five stars. A few say that it doesn't clean the skin well, but most say that it is extremely gentle on sensitive skin and that it cleans effectively.

Review: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ser, Contributors to Drugstore.com
